Overview
On Site
Depends on Experience
Accepts corp to corp applications
Contract - Independent
Contract - W2
Skills
Ansible
Capacity Management
Collaboration
Computer Networking
Configuration Management
Continuous Delivery
Continuous Integration
DevOps
Docker
GitLab
HAProxy
Hardening
High Availability
Jenkins
Kubernetes
Lifecycle Management
Linux
Load Balancing
Management
Network
OpenStack
Performance Tuning
Provisioning
Red Hat Enterprise Linux
Red Hat Linux
Scalability
Servers
System Security
Writing
Job Details
Role: Opemstack Engineer / Admin
Location: Remote
Type: Contract Position
Job description:
Key Responsibilities:
- Install, configure, and maintain Red Hat OpenStack environments to ensure high availability, scalability, and performance.
- Manage RHEL 8 servers, including writing and maintaining systemd services for custom applications.
- Implement, manage, and troubleshoot Kubernetes clusters and Docker/Podman container environments.
- Build and deploy automation solutions using Ansible for configuration management and infrastructure provisioning.
- Develop and maintain CI/CD pipelines for seamless integration and deployment across environments.
- Configure and optimize HAProxy for load balancing and high availability of critical services.
- Utilize Helm charts for managing Kubernetes application deployments and versioning.
- Administer and monitor Docker Swarm environments where applicable.
- Perform proactive monitoring, capacity planning, and performance tuning of Linux and container infrastructure.
- Collaborate with development, DevOps, and network teams to ensure reliable and secure infrastructure operations.
Required Skills & Experience:
- Strong hands-on experience with Red Hat Enterprise Linux (RHEL 8) and OpenStack Administration.
- Proficiency in Kubernetes, Docker/Podman, and container lifecycle management.
- Experience in CI/CD tools (Jenkins, GitLab CI, etc.) for automated deployment.
- Good understanding of HAProxy, Helm, and Docker Swarm.
- Proven skills in Ansible for automation and configuration management.
- Solid grasp of networking concepts, Linux services, and system security hardening.
- Ability to troubleshoot complex infrastructure issues and ensure high uptime.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.